WebThe first world record in the women's shot put was recognised by the Fédération Sportive Féminine Internationale (FSFI) in 1924. The FSFI was absorbed by the International Association of Athletics Federations in 1936. These women's distances were achieved with a 4 kilograms (8.8 lb) shot put. Olympic men: 16 pounds (7.25 kilograms)High School boys: 12 pounds (5.44 kilograms)Olympic and High School girls, Middle School boys: 8.8 pounds (4 kilograms)Middle School girls: 6 pounds (2.7 kilograms) bizhawk filter hq4xOlder athletes compete in five age groups. Men 30 to 49 years old continue using the 16 lb. shot used by open age group men. Fifty-year-old men use a 13.2 lb. weight. The weight of the shot decreases by 2.2 lb. every decade.
